FROM COUNCILOR TO CONTROVERSY: THE AQUINO ROMANCE

Shalani’s political career began humbly. After working as a local government staffer and a news reporter covering Congress, she successfully ran for Valenzuela City Councilor (2004-2013), where she focused on early childhood welfare. Her public image was one of sincerity and community focus.

However, her life exploded onto the national stage due to her highly publicized romantic relationship with then-Congressman Noynoy “Pinoy” Aquino, starting in mid-2008. Their relationship, which began after meeting at a steak house, was dubbed a “Metropolitan Fairy Tale”: a councilor dating a prominent political heir who would soon become President.

The romance ended abruptly in October 2010, shortly after Aquino became President. Shalani attributed the split to their intensely busy schedules and lack of time, admitting that, like any human being, she was “hurt and cried.”

THE TV STAR GAMBLE AND THE UNFULFILLED DREAM

Post-breakup, Shalani made a sensational pivot, accepting an invitation to co-host the prime-time game show Willing Willie on TV5 in 2010. This was a massive gamble: a quiet councilor trading her political background for the high-energy chaos of showbiz. Though initially nervous and criticized for being “too modest,” she embraced the new world as a way “to forget the wounds of the past and give herself a new start.”

The celebrity chapter was short-lived but intense. After failing to win a congressional seat in 2013, she refocused on her personal life, marrying Pasig Congressman Roman Romulo in January 2012.
